IP查询
查询
你查询的IP:[123.206.189.220] 地理位置:中国–上海–上海
最新查询
219.72.108.210
124.250.157.167
221.176.208.167
124.254.217.146
220.252.107.153
161.207.115.206
222.128.144.210
118.126.198.241
221.196.166.155
123.206.189.220
58.144.16.13
60.55.34.64
119.63.32.195
125.215.246.59
119.253.177.225
221.133.224.56
124.40.128.249
203.161.192.232
124.108.8.169
220.192.12.60
203.80.144.149
203.135.160.86
122.144.128.24
210.14.112.208
202.38.149.179
220.232.64.235
117.24.170.76
118.91.240.127
121.32.130.220
117.76.47.138
218.249.155.179